Today we had a very special Reconciliation Chapel service. Perry Wandin Wundjeri elder presided over a smoking ceremony and the Rev Helen Dwyer a chaplain at Overnewton Anglican College captivated the children with an explanation of how her friend Flossy the possum needed to be accepted for who she is, a possum! The analogy with Aboriginal people was strong and clear. Our children were beautifully composed and attentive throughout the service.

Recently Christ Church hosted a visit from Year 11 and 12 students from Ilim Islamic College of Australia. Father Paul gave an introduction to the Christian faith and spoke of the significance of Abraham in both our traditions. When I joined the discussion, I spoke about my journey to ordination and the slow realisation that God was calling me to use my teaching skills in his service. We spent a happy and fruitful time together and the teachers accompanying the group are keen to encourage ongoing dialogue between Christian and Muslim students. They hope to reciprocate our hospitality at a future date. As part of their Religious Education, Year 6 will visit the Jewish Museum and a Synagogue later in the year.

Areyonga Thank you to everyone who supported Areyonga in our recent Long Walk Fundraiser. Altogether with the lollie Jar, The Raffle and about 50 walkers on the Long Walk, we have raised over $550 for Areyonga. This money has been passed on to Darren of Red Dust, who will decide how to benefit the Areyonga community with the money we raised. I'd also like to quickly thank Leanne Brooke from the Long Walk Australia for providing our amazing raffle prizes. For those of you wondering about Areyonga, it is a remote indigenous community located about 225 kilometres south west of Alice Springs, in the Central Desert of the Northern Territory. With only about 220 people living in the community, it is quite small. Areyonga has a Primary School, where the kids are divided into 2 classes, one for the younger kids in year 1, 2 and 3 and another class for the older kids in year 4, 5 and 6. There is no secondary school in Areyonga, so after Year 6 the kids have to leave Areyonga to go to school elsewhere, or they just don't go to school any more at all. Some of our Year 6's are looking forward to spending a few days with the Areyonga community in our September school holidays, and particularly spending time with the Areyonga kids in their school. This is a very special opportunity that we have at CCGS because of our relationship with Red Dust, an organisation which works to improve health in remote indigenous communities, and they have a strong connection to the Areyonga community. We are looking forward to strengthening our friendship with the Areyonga community, and learning more about their lives, when we visit them in September. Jude Harrington
